LINCOLN, NB – All eastbound lanes of I-20 were shut down Friday morning after a semi-truck collided with an overpass near Riverside, according to WVTM.
First responders say the truck collided with a wall on the Coosa River Bridge shortly before 11 a.m.
It is unclear whether anyone suffered injuries as a result of the collision; however, significant traffic delays were reported in the area for some time following the crash while crews worked to clear the scene.
All lanes have since reopened.
